Laryngeal cancer is one of the most common malignant neoplasm in head and neck.Although a number of the patients with laryngeal cancer were saved by surgery operation, radiotherapy, chemotherapy and Laser, there are about 30-40% patients with laryngeal cancer died of recurrence and metastasis of carcinoma. Advancing of molecular biological technique, gene therapy of carcinoma will bring hope to the patients with carcinoma .To investigate the ability of acceleration of apoptosis and inhibition of Hep-2 proliferation by down-regulation eIF4E expression , observe the effects on apoptosis and proliferation in Hep-2 after 10-23DNAzyme3-eIF4E tranfected,s. he identification of new molecular targets may lead to more effective treatment for laryngeal cancer.More and more studies show suppression of apoptosis plays a critical role in tumor initiation,progression . Eukaryotic initiation factor 4E (eIF4E)was a hot spot of oncologic research. It was an important factor to adjust protein synthesis and affect the neoplastic development. In normal, eIF4E expressed at low level. The overexpression of eIF4E selectively adjusted some protein that was important...
